Entry Requirements
Minimum requirements
University Entrance, as defined by the NZQA; or * Evidence regarded as sufficient by the Head of School of the capability to undertake and complete the programme of study; or * At the discretion of the Head of School, where the applicant is over 20 years of age and demonstrates the capability to undertake and complete the programme of study. * RANK score of 200 based on your top 80 credits or equivalent * essay score; * interview/s score. The College may be satisfied that an applicant meets English language standards with the following: * If English is the applicant's first language, or. * If the applicant has a New Zealand university entrance qualification, or. * If the applicant has an overseas university entrance qualification from a country where the main language is English and the main language of instruction and assessment for the qualification is English, or. * If the applicant is 20 years or older and is a New Zealand citizen or permanent resident. * The applicant provides a valid IELTS certificate. The standard of English Language competence that the College requires is, or is equivalent to, an Academic IELTS overall score of 7.0, with no individual language skill under 6.5
